Attackers can exploit command injection vulnerabilities to delete core system runtime files, causing the monitoring module to crash and become paralyzed; simultaneously, they can obtain root privileges to steal configuration passwords such as SNMP, thereby tampering with critical system parameters and triggering abnormal operation of the entire power system.
